IBEX is a holding company. Through its subsidiaries, Co. provides customer lifecycle experience (CLX) solutions. Through its CLX platform, a portfolio of solutions is provided to support customer acquisition, engagement, expansion and experience for clients. Co.'s services cover three areas: Digital and Omni-Channel Customer Experience, which delivers customer service, technical support, revenue generation, and other outsourced back office services; Digital Marketing and E-Commerce, which provides digital marketing, e-commerce technology, and platform solutions; and Digital customer experience surveys and analytics, which measure, monitor and manage its clients' customer experiences.
